What is a fundamental duty of a funeral director in Ohio?

A fundamental duty of a funeral director in Ohio is to be ultimately responsible for the funeral home. This role encompasses the oversight of all operational activities, ensuring compliance with legal regulations, managing staff, and maintaining the ethical standards of the profession. It is essential for the funeral director to ensure that the needs of the families they serve are met compassionately and professionally, which includes complete responsibility for all aspects of funeral service and care.

While managing cremation processes, writing obituaries, and determining burial locations are important tasks associated with funeral services, they fall under the broader scope of responsibilities that the funeral director supervises. However, the overarching duty is the management and operation of the funeral home as a whole, which plays a pivotal role in providing quality service to the community in times of grief.
